77% of Employers Plan to Focus on Increasing Mental Health Access in 2024

The majority of large employers report seeing the impact of increased mental health issues in the wake of the COVID-19 pandemic. That’s according to the Business Group on Health’s 2024 Large Employer Healthcare Strategy Survey, which included responses from 152 employers representing 19 million covered lives. Kyros Raises $10.5M for Digital Substance Use Disorder Treatment Marketplace

Digital substance use disorder platform Kyros has raised another $10.5 million in funding, public records reveal. This new infusion of capital brings the company’s total raise to roughly $17.3 million. Eleanor Health Founder, CEO Corbin Petro Stepping Down

Corbin Petro, founder and CEO of hybrid substance use disorder (SUD) provider Eleanor Health, announced her plans to resign. Acorn Health Names New CEO to Lead the Growing ABA Provider

Autism therapy provider Acorn Health has announced Richard Hallworth as the Coral Gables, Florida-based company’s new president and CEO. He succeeds founding CEO Vicki Kroviak and takes over the role after Janet Widmann stepped in on an interim basis on Dec. 8. Kroviak stepped down from the CEO position. Verily’s SUD Organization OneFifteen Cuts Ties with Samaritan, Moves Toward Full Provider Status

OneFifteen is moving from a management service organization to a full substance use disorder (SUD) provider, parting ways with its former operating partner, Samaritan Behavioral Health.
